I tried buying something on the steam store using the steam deck as well and I got the unexpected error message. I think the reason for this is because the steam store in the deck doesn’t provide the option to allow the popup window. If I remember correctly I had to open the steam deck in desktop mode and go to the steam store from there. I don’t remember if I used the browser or the steam app to access the store, but which ever process I used I was able to go through the validation process, because in this mode you have the option to allow tabs to popup. Since then I haven’t tried buying anything on steam at all, so it’s possible that after allowing the popup tab the first time, will allow me to buy things from the steam deck store. However I didn’t test this as like I said I haven’t bought anything since.
